What Are Geotextile Fabrics?

Geotextile Fabric is a type of synthetic textile fabric that is used in civil engineering and construction projects to enhance the behavior of soil. It is usually composed of polypropylene, polyester or other synthetic fabrics.

Fabric is used to separate, filter, reinforce, drain or control erosion between soil, aggregates, sand, drainage layers or between construction materials and serve different purposes.

Geotextile Fabric is a fabric designed for ground stabilization and construction applications, as compared to a common piece of cloth or weed cloth. It helps limit mixing of the soil, aids in water movement as needed, and enhances long-term performance of roads, embankments, retaining structures and drainage facilities.

Available Geotextile Fabric Types

Woven Geotextile Fabric

Fabric is created using synthetic fibres in order to make a strong fabric with a strong tensile strength. It is suitable for embankments, road construction as well as separation and reinforcement support.

Non-Woven Geotextile Fabric

Fabricated through the bonding of synthetic fibers typically utilized for drainage, filtration protection layers, as well as erosion control.

Geotextile Sheet for Road Work

It is used below highways, roads, roads, and railway beds to break up soil layers and provide long-term stability.

Drainage Geotextile Fabric

The system is specifically designed for areas that require water filtration and control drainage are essential like the trench drains, French drains and subsurface drainage.

Geotextile Sheet vs Geomembrane

Property Geotextile Sheet Geomembrane
Main Function Separation, filtration, drainage, reinforcement support Waterproofing and encapsulation
Structure Permeable fabric Liner impermeable
Water Movement Lets you filter or drain depending on the type Blocks water leakage
Common Use Roads, drainage, embankments, erosion control Tanks, landfills, ponds containment areas, ponds
Soil Support Good Limited
Installation Role Stabilization and layers of filtration Barrier layer
Best For Drainage and ground improvement Prevention of leakage

Geotextile Sheets are selected for soil stabilization and separation and filtration is required. Geomembrane is chosen if the project needs the protection of a waterproof or containment layer.

Geotextile vs Uniaxial Geogrid

Property Geotextile Uniaxial Geogrid
Product Form Sheet of fabric or roll Grid structure
Main Function Separation from filtration, separation, drainage and support In one direction, soil reinforcement
Strength Direction Fabric-based strength High Tensile Strength in Machine direction
Common Use Roads, drainage, filtration, embankments Retaining walls and steep slopes reinforced soil structures
Water Flow Can be used to support drainage and filtration Open grid allows soil interlock
Best For Separation of layers and drainage support Transfer of loads and reinforcement
Buyer Need Stabilization of soils and the filtration Structural reinforcement

Geotextile is a better choice for separation, filtration and drainage. Uniaxial Geogrid is a better choice for projects that require sturdy soil reinforcement that is one-directional.
